Credit: Lynda Bullock/Watford Observer Camera Club Watford s mayor says he agrees it is important to preserve Watford s heritage after he was asked for his thoughts about a plan to demolish an historic clock tower. At a full council meeting on Tuesday night, Watford Labour leader Cllr Nigel Bell asked Peter Taylor whether he agreed the proposed demolition of the Sun Printers Clock Tower would be a bad blow for the heritage of the town. It comes after an application was submitted to Watford Borough Council last month by a man called Paul Stacey to knock the clock tower in Ascot Road down.
